Recombination between the two progenitor insertions has resulted in the deletion of the intervening sequence between them, producing a 19.7kb deletion that completely removes LpR1.
Deletion of LpR1 resulting from FLP-catalyzed recombination using the FRT-containing transposons P{XP}d10508 and P{XP}d03066.
In the LpR1Df/+ and LpR1Df/LpR1Df larval brain, LNv neurons show decreased dendritic volume. The LpR1Df/LpR1Df optic lobe presents decreased lipid droplet density.
The expression of LpR1UAS.H.GFP under the control of Scer\GAL4P2.4.Pdf in LpR1Df/LpR1Df, leads to LNv neurons in the larval brain to exuberant dendritic branches extended beyond the synaptic region.
Homozygous females lay eggs which hatch at rates similar to that of wild-type females.
Homozygous stage 10 egg chambers have a normal neutral lipid content.
Homozygous larval wing discs have normal levels of intracellular lipid droplets.
LpR1Df is rescued by LpR1UAS.G.GFP/Scer\GAL4P2.4.Pdf
LpR1Df is rescued by LpR1UAS.H.GFP/Scer\GAL4P2.4.Pdf
